411323
Epoch

Epoch Number
411323
Finalized
Yes
Age
60 days 5 hrs ago (Dec-03-2025 02:27:35 PM +UTC)
Attestations
211

Participation Rate
98.18%
Voted Ether
2,270,118 ETH
Eligible Ether
2,312,100 ETH

Slashing P/A
0/0
Deposits
0
Voluntary Exits
0

Total Validator Count
2154200
Active Count
2153157
Pending Count
1043